Matthew 19:14On each of Second’s six campuses, there is a wall in the SecondKids area that is decorated with the handprints of children. After a child prays to receive Christ and meets with a pastor, a baptism date is set. As soon as possible after the scheduled baptism, the child is invited to place his/her handprint on the wall along with their first name and baptism date. It is a great visual and a clear testimony to the importance we place on children and our ministry to them and their families. Make Your Mark: Building the Next Generation is a two-year campaign to pledge and give $36.5 million to finance the construction of the new Children’s Building. Other provisions of the campaign include the demolition of the current F Building, the creation of additional parking spaces adjacent to the new building, and significant improvements to the first floor of A Building. The structural steel is now in place and is clearly visible against the skyline. With a projected completion date in mid-2023, this new building will better equip us to reach children and prepare them to “make a mark’’ on this and future generations.
